202009-29 python mysql自增字段AUTO_INCREMENT值的修改方式 在之前得文章中我们说过,如果使用delete对数据库中得表进行删除,那么只是把记录删除掉,并且id的值还会保持上次的状态。即删除之前如果有四条数据,删除之后,再添加新的数据,id怎会从5开始。但是我们显示想让id从2开始,应该怎么做呢?这个时候我们就要学习去修改数据表的一些属性值了,而这个属性值就是AUTO_INCREMENT。首先我们要知道怎么查看这个属性的值。例如我建了一张表:createtablet4(idintauto_incrementprimar... 继续阅读 >
202009-24 django自定义非主键自增字段类型详解(auto increment field) 1.django自定义字段类型,实现非主键字段的自增#-*-encoding:utf-8-*-fromdjango.db.models.fieldsimportField,IntegerFieldfromdjango.coreimportchecks,exceptionsfromdjango.utils.translationimportugettext_lazyas_classAutoIncreField(Field):description=_("Integer")empty_strings_allowed=Falsedefault_error_messages={'invalid':_("'%(value)s'valuemustbeaninteger."),}def__init... 继续阅读 >